What Makes a Book a High Fantasy Romance?

Before we delve into our list, let's quickly define what we mean by high fantasy romance books. High fantasy is a subgenre of fantasy that features extensive world-building, mythical creatures, and epic quests. When you add a healthy dose of romance to the mix, you get high fantasy romance – stories that combine the thrill of adventure with the heart-fluttering excitement of love.

High fantasy romance books often feature:

- Complex, intricate worlds that feel like they could be real - Mythical creatures and magical systems that add depth and wonder - Epic quests and high-stakes adventures - Romance that's woven into the fabric of the story, driving the plot and character development
